The SNJ54LS20W is a high-quality integrated circuit from the reputable manufacturer Texas Instruments, renowned for their precision engineering and reliable electronic components. This particular chip belongs to the 54LS series, which is a subset of the broader LS (Low-power Schottky) family, known for combining the low power consumption of CMOS with the higher speeds of TTL circuits.
Key Features
- Dual 4-Input NAND Gates: The SNJ54LS20W contains two independent 4-input NAND gates, making it versatile for a variety of logical functions within electronic circuits.
- Military Specifications: As indicated by the "SNJ" prefix, this device meets military specifications, ensuring its performance under extreme conditions and making it suitable for use in defense and aerospace applications.
- Ceramic Flat Pack: The product is housed in a sturdy ceramic flat pack, providing excellent thermal and mechanical protection, which is essential for reliability and longevity in harsh environments.
- Wide Operating Temperature Range: It operates effectively over a broad temperature range, making it adaptable for various industrial and military applications.
